Abstract

The invention relates to the technical field of helmet machining, in particular to helmet shell grinding equipment which comprises a platform, a placing table, a positioning jacking unit, a surrounding grinding unit and a dustproof unit, and the positioning jacking unit completes clamping and locking from the inner side of a helmet through a clamping assembly and lifts the helmet; the surrounding grinding unit drives a grinding machine to move around the helmet through an annular supporting frame, and self-adaptive grinding can be achieved through a lifting mechanism, a retracting mechanism and an overturning mechanism. According to the helmet polishing device, automation, comprehensiveness and environmental protection of helmet polishing are achieved, the polishing efficiency and quality are improved, and the helmet polishing device is suitable for the helmet batch production scene.

[0002] A helmet is a piece of equipment that provides exceptional protection for the head. It is commonly used in military training and combat, as well as in transportation and industrial production. It is usually semi-circular and consists of three main parts: the outer shell, the lining, and the suspension device. Ancient helmets were mainly made of leather, cotton, linen, and metal, while in modern times they are also made of resin or plastic.

[0003] After a helmet is manufactured, it often needs to be sanded and polished to facilitate subsequent painting. However, polishing requires manual labor, which leads to low efficiency and increased labor costs. [0047] The working principle of this helmet shell grinding equipment is as follows:

[0048] Helmet positioning and clamping: The worker places the helmet upside down on the placement platform 2. After the machine is started, the control motor 23 inside the placement platform 2 drives the bidirectional screw 24 to rotate. The bidirectional screw 24 causes the movable frames 26 on both sides to move equidistantly to both sides. The movable frames 26 move synchronously through the connecting seat 27 and the spring, which drives the transmission control plate 11. The L-shaped frame 10 drives the transmission control plate 11 to move laterally along the positioning block 12. The transmission control plate 11 drives the piston 13 to move inside the piston tube 14. The air inside the cavity 15 enters the positioning tube 16. The sensing piston 19 moves laterally accordingly. The fixing rod 20 drives the locking clip 17 to move. The locking clips 17 on both sides cooperate with each other to clamp and lock the helmet from the inside.

[0049] Height increase: After clamping the helmet, the movable frame 26 continues to move, and the spring located between the connecting seat 27 and the L-shaped frame 10 is stretched. The movable frame 26 drives the guide control 25 into the inside of the guide control tube 32, which in turn drives the air inside the guide control box 28 to enter the inside of the control slot 31 along the lifting control tube 29. In conjunction with the control piston 30, the lifting column 9 is raised.

[0050] Automatic polishing: First, the detector 42 scans the shape of the helmet surface, the lifting control component 41 controls the lifting plate 36 to rise and fall, and the retraction control component 38, through the control block 39 and the connecting rod 40, realizes the retraction and extension of the retraction frame 37, and adjusts the height of the polishing machine 45 and the distance between the polishing machine 45 and the helmet. Then, the flip motor 44 adjusts the angle of the polishing machine 45 through the mounting base 43, and in conjunction with the detector 42, enables the polishing machine 45 to precisely polish the helmet.

[0051] Surrounding operation: The rotary motor 34 drives the support ring frame 33 to rotate through the pulley and belt, and the grinder 45 rotates around the helmet. With the help of height adjustment, distance adjustment and angle adjustment, the grinder 45 can perform a thorough and comprehensive grinding of the helmet surface.

[0052] Dust handling: During grinding, the dust pump 49 runs, and the dust enters the inside of the filter cartridge 48 along the dust suction pipe 46. The filter frame 50 filters the dust, and the air after dust removal is discharged to the outside of the platform 1 along the dust pump 49. The cleaning motor 47 drives the rotating rod 18 to rotate, and the rotating rod 18 cleans the filter frame 50 through the cleaning brush 51.
